LONDON BROKER RATINGS: Exane BNP and HSBC cut BP; JPM likes Barclays

12th Feb 2026 09:46

(Alliance News) - The following London-listed shares received analyst recommendations Thursday morning and on Wednesday:

----------

FTSE 100

----------

Exane BNP cuts BP to 'neutral' (outperform) - price target 465 pence

----------

HSBC cuts BP to 'reduce' - price target 430 pence

----------

UBS cuts BP price target to 455 (465) pence - 'neutral'

----------

Goldman Sachs raises AstraZeneca price target to 16,496 (16,389) pence - 'buy'

----------

LBBW raises AstraZeneca price target to 16,000 (14,000) pence - 'buy'

----------

JPMorgan raises Barclays price target to 590 (570) pence - 'overweight'

----------

JPMorgan cuts NatWest price target to 730 (750) pence - 'overweight'

----------

RBC cuts Barratt Redrow price target to 425 (450) pence - 'sector perform'

----------

FTSE 250

----------

Panmure Liberum raises Ashmore Group price target to 350 (240) pence - 'buy'

----------

JPMorgan reinitiates Unite Group with 'overweight' - price target 725 pence

----------

Jefferies cuts HgCapital Trust to 'underperform' (hold)

----------

SMALL CAP

----------

Goldman Sachs cuts Flutter Entertainment price target to 19,700 (22,300) pence - 'buy'

----------

JPMorgan raises Smurfit Westrock target to 5,000 (4,300) pence - 'overweight'

----------

RBC cuts MJ Gleeson price target to 375 (400) pence - 'underperform'
